Mental Health Support

Mental health support is an imperative facet of well-being, often overshadowed by the clamor of daily life. In a world marked by increasing stressors and challenges, the need for mental health support has never been more evident. Here, in a serious tone, we delve into this essential aspect of human existence.
  1. The Silent Struggles: Mental health issues often reside beneath a veneer of normalcy. The suffering is silent, concealed behind smiles and everyday interactions. Many individuals grapple with their inner demons without voicing their turmoil.
  2. Stigma and Misunderstanding: Stigma surrounding mental health concerns persists, causing individuals to hesitate in seeking support. Misconceptions and prejudices cast shadows over those who reach out for help, perpetuating feelings of isolation.
  3. Varied and Complex: Mental health issues are diverse and intricate. They encompass conditions such as anxiety, depression, b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, and more. Each condition demands unique approaches to diagnosis and treatment.
  4. The Power of Listening: Often, the most potent form of support is a compassionate and attentive ear. The act of listening without judgment can provide solace to those burdened by mental health challenges.
  5. Professional Help: In many cases, mental health support necessitates the expertise of mental health professionals. Psychiatrists, psychologists, therapists, and counselors offer tailored guidance and therapeutic interventions to help individuals regain their equilibrium.
  6. Community and Peer Support: Peer support groups and community organizations play a crucial role in mental health support. They create safe spaces where individuals can share their experiences and learn from others facing similar challenges.
  7. Preventative Measures: Mental health support is not solely reactive. Preventative measures, such as stress management, self-care practices, and early intervention, are vital in maintaining mental well-being.
  8. Holistic Approach: The interplay between mental and physical health cannot be ignored. A holistic approach that addresses nutrition, exercise, and overall lifestyle can significantly impact mental health.
  9. Long-Term Journey: Recovery from mental health issues is often a protracted journey. Patience and perseverance are essential, as progress may be gradual, with setbacks along the way.
  10. The Value of Empathy: For those supporting individuals with mental health challenges, empathy is paramount. Understanding the nuances of their struggles and offering unwavering support can make a profound difference in their lives.
  11. Breaking the Silence: Fostering open dialogue about mental health is a powerful tool in reducing stigma. Initiatives that encourage conversation and destigmatize seeking help are instrumental in promoting mental well-being.

In the realm of mental health support, the importance of empathy, understanding, and accessible resources cannot be overstated. It is a matter that transcends cultural, social, and demographic boundaries, affecting people from all walks of life. Thus, taking it seriously and addressing it with compassion is a duty we owe to ourselves and to one another.
